Final Thursday Reading Series featuring Thomas Hockey & Doug Shaw

Thursday, April 29, 2021 - 7:00 pm

This event brings out the literary sides of, respectively, a UNI scientist and a UNI mathematician.  Thomas Hockey is a professor of Astronomy and the co-author of Jupiter, a nonfiction book on planetary studies with a distinctively creative twist. He has written seven previous books including Galileo’s Planet and How We See the Sky. Doug Shaw is a professor of Mathematics who has won many awards for his teaching. He’s written about mathematics, applied improvisation, mathematics teaching, and his secret rabbis. He is the author of Social Nonsense—Creative Diversions for Two or More Players – Anytime, Anywhere.
